ADDITIONAL FAQs
6.
The Official Rules say that my name shouldn't be on my screenplay,
but I accidentally left my name on or in my screenplay. Will I be
disqualified? If I review a screenplay with a name on it, should
I give it a lower rating because of that?
A
number of Greenlight Contestants may have inadvertently placed their
name(s) or other personally identifiable information on or in their
respective screenplays. Although the Official Rules permit us to
subject such screenplays to disqualification, Greenlight has decided
not to disqualify any screenplay submitted by a Contestant or Team
that fails to meet the Submission Requirements as set forth in the
Official Rules, where such failure was solely because of the placement
of a Contestant's name(s) or other personally identifying information
on or in the screenplay submitted. In light of this, there is no
need for any review to give a lower rating to a screenplay with
a name on it, solely because of the presence of such name.
